Movies fall into different genres, and understanding those genres—and what the audience expects when going to a film in a certain genre—is extremely important. If mom and dad bring their 5- and 7-year-olds to your film called Fun with Woodland Creatures expecting a romp in the woods with furry squirrels and quizzical owls and instead they find a group of unsuspecting college kids on a camping trip battling the bloody undead, and various bug-eyed zombies, well, that family is not going to be too happy. We go to films with expectations. We’re ‘in the mood’ for a romantic comedy or we’re in the mood for a fast-paced thriller—and if we go to one expecting the other, we won’t be as satisfied.
